The Group Facilitator is responsible for providing the highest-quality care and services by delivering the highest level of group engagement to clients. Group Facilitators must be able to show empathy and compassion towards all clients. Group Facilitators must understand the 12-step, Indigenous cultural healing, and SMART recovery models. Group Facilitators are responsible for guiding clients through their recovery by facilitating group therapy, process group sessions, and workshops. This person will ensure that they follow the policies, procedures, and regulations set forth by Together We Can, as well as our licensing/registration requirements. .
What you will do
- Develop and facilitate process groups for participants and families that include relapse prevention, life skills, CBT & DBT, coping skills, goal setting, and family healing.
- Interact courteously and tactfully with clients, co-workers, family members, visitors and the public
- Establish and maintain rapport with clients
- Resolve conflicts and provide crisis intervention
- Debrief to Supervisors as required
- Communicate efficiently and effectively as a member of the Counselling Team
- Document communication with participants through case and journal notes
- Expand group material in response to changing participant demographics
- Continue to grow professionally and develop personal standards
- Maintain the Standard of Care and professionalism as set by the Society
